Output 0865487a99b70d91fab81e6ca716bf61ba7b197d9cbac865acf28582fc7b3ec1:0

value
510667
script pubkey
OP_0 OP_PUSHBYTES_20 225ee0fdcdc7c93dd707d3b3e15422e24db3c6ed
address
bc1qyf0wplwdclynm4c86we7z4pzufxm83hdnya55m
transaction
0865487a99b70d91fab81e6ca716bf61ba7b197d9cbac865acf28582fc7b3ec1
confirmations
96120
spent
true